#BDBF7D Hex Color Code

#BDBF7D

The Hexadecimal Color #BDBF7D is a contrast shade of Dark Khaki. #BDBF7D RGB value is rgb(189, 191, 125). RGB Color Model of #BDBF7D consists of 74% red, 74% green and 49% blue. HSL color Mode of #BDBF7D has 62°(degrees) Hue, 34% Saturation and 62% Lightness. #BDBF7D color has an wavelength of 580.96296n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#BDBF7D is #CCCC99.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#BDBF7D is #BB7. The Closest Color to #BDBF7D is #BDB76B. Official Name of #BDBF7D Hex Code is Gimblet.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#BDBF7D is 1 Cyan 0 Magenta 35 Yellow 25 Black and #BDBF7D CMY is 1, 0, 35.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#BDBF7D is hsl(62,34,62,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(62, 35, 75).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#BDBF7D is 43.32, 49.56, 26.68.
Hex8 Value of #BDBF7D is #BDBF7DFF. Decimal Value of #BDBF7D is 12435325 and Octal Value of #BDBF7D is 57337575. Binary Value of #BDBF7D is 10111101, 10111111, 1111101 and Android of #BDBF7D is 4290625405 / 0xffbdbf7d.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#BDBF7D is 0.362, 0.415, 0.415 and YIQ Color Space of #BDBF7D is 182.878, 20.014, -20.9622.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#BDBF7D is 48.7, 53.81, 27.04.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#BDBF7D is 75.8, -10.9, 33.12.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#BDBF7D is 75.8, 2.05, 45.58.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#BDBF7D is 75.8, 34.87, 108.22. Hunter Lab variable of #BDBF7D is 70.4, -13.36, 26.81.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#BDBF7D

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
